We use cookies for the following reasons:
- Analytical purposes - measuring unique
visitors and visitor behaviour in order to improve our
website
- Your account - we use cookies to track the
identity of authenticated users, so we can remember the
preferences of each user and give them access to their
data (as opposed to data of other users)
- 3rd party integration - where a user activates
the integration of 3rd party services such as twitter
within mysparebrain, those 3rd party services will
typically use cookies to identify and track the user
according to the conditions of users' acounts with those
services.
We consider these cookies to be essential to the offering
of the service.

This website uses Google Analytics, a web analytics service
provided by Google, Inc. (“Google”). Google Analytics uses
“cookies”, which are text files placed on your computer, to
help the website analyze how users use the site. The
information generated by the cookie about your use of the
website (including your IP address) will be transmitted to and
stored by Google on servers in the United States . Google will
use this information for the purpose of evaluating your use of
the website, compiling reports on website activity for website
operators and providing other services relating to website
activity and internet usage. Google may also transfer this
information to third parties where required to do so by law, or
where such third parties process the information on Google's
behalf. Google will not associate your IP address with any
other data held by Google. You may refuse the use of cookies
by selecting the appropriate settings on your browser, however
please note that if you do this you may not be able to use the
full functionality of this website. By using this website, you
consent to the processing of data about you by Google in the
manner and for the purposes set out above.
